NORTH MEMPHIS, Tenn. (FOX13) -

Several businesses and a club were damaged in an overnight fire Tuesday that consumed a strip mall in North Memphis.

Firefighters responded to the fire at around 2:50 a.m. in the 3900 block of Jackson Avenue and saw the fire was well involved from the one-story structure.

The fire was extinguished some 80 minutes later.

Firefighters said the structure did not have a working sprinkler system and the fire caused around $20,000 in damages.

The cause of the fire remains under investigation. There were no reported injuries.
